Living with a chronic illness can feel profoundly isolating.
Chronic illness can feel like it builds walls around you. When your body limits what you can do, and your energy feels like it’s always running on empty, it’s easy to feel cut off from the world. Friends might not understand why you cancel plans, and even family can struggle to grasp what you’re facing. The result? A deep, aching loneliness that’s hard to express.
Many of us know what it’s like to miss out on milestones, to wonder if anyone truly understands. That’s why this space exists: to bridge that gap. Here, you’ll find people who recognize the exhaustion behind a simple “I’m fine,” and who appreciate that just showing up, in any way you can, matters.

Community Guidelines
To ensure this space remains safe, welcoming, and supportive for everyone, we have a few simple but important guidelines:
18+ Community: For safety and comfort, our server is exclusively for adults (18+). This helps us create an environment where members can openly discuss their experiences without concern.
Respect, Kindness, and Empathy: We strive to maintain a culture of understanding, patience, and support. Treat others with respect, offer kindness, and remember that everyone here is facing their own challenges.
No Uncivil Behavior: Harassment, bullying, discrimination, or hostility of any kind will not be tolerated. We take this seriously and will enforce it to keep our community a safe space.
Healthy Boundaries in Friendships: We encourage genuine friendships to form, but this is a space for connection and support—not for unsolicited private approaches. Engaging in meaningful discussions in public spaces helps build trust. Repeated private advances toward members, especially without participating in the community, is not appropriate.
Moderation and Enforcement:
We are committed to maintaining this culture. If necessary, we will step in to ensure the community remains welcoming and inclusive for everyone.
New to Discord?
If you’ve never used Discord before, don’t worry—it’s just another website/app people use to chat and connect! It’s similar to other messaging platforms, with text channels for different topics and voice channels for talking in real-time. If you can send a text or join a group chat, you can use Discord!
